Here's another spare-time project I’ve wasted about 10 nights or so, finished this last Friday.
Short concept idea for this image was this:
She escaped from slave traders’ harem and now she tries to find her way across the desert…
I spent most of time working on clothing designs and building atmospheric effects. Modeled and rendered in 3dsmax6. Textures and patterns + bump maps were painted in Photoshop CS.
Some notes about this render:
- Displacement + bump maps were used heavily (and heavily subdivided meshes.
- Character was skinned and posed (short animation for clothing to be able to conform properly)
- Cloth simulation was used to setup cloth fabrics in scene.
- All textures and patterns were painted in photoshop, except bone texture which i started building from old rock side photo i shot last summer...
- Diamonds were made with help of Blur Studio's great shellac material and a few environment maps.
